Summary
Jean-séverin Lair is a senior French digital transformation leader with nine years in executive IT roles and a public-sector career spanning ministries, La Poste and transversal bodies. He has directed large, multi-stakeholder programs (notably the €56M VITAM national digital archiving program) and scaled engineering organizations, most recently leading a 430‑person DSI at INSEE. Comfortable at the intersection of strategy, product and delivery, he favors agile, product-mode execution and keeps strong internal technical expertise across data, big‑data and cloud-native platforms. A Polytechnique and Télécom Paris alumnus, he blends rigorous engineering training with hands‑on program delivery and a long record in public digital services. He remains focused on innovation and impact, with a particular interest in the frontier opportunities opened by AI.
